The PV cell manufacturing process utilises various hazardous materials, including hydrochloric acid, sulfuric acid, nitric acid, hydrogen fluoride, 1,1,1-trichloroethane, and acetone. These chemicals are necessary for cleaning and purifying the semiconductor surface. Safety, Hazards, and. .
